4 Definitions General Product data applies under the following conditions: Three hours storage at ambient temperature followed by 30 minutes warm-up operation Specified environmental conditions met Recommended calibration interval adhered to All internal automatic adjustments performed, if applicable Specifications with limits Represent warranted product performance by means of a range of values for the specified parameter. These specifications are marked with limiting symbols such as <,, >,, ±, or descriptions such as maximum, limit of, minimum. Compliance is ensured by testing or is derived from the design. Test limits are narrowed by guard bands to take into account measurement uncertainties, drift and aging, if applicable. Specifications without limits Represent warranted product performance for the specified parameter. These specifications are not specially marked and represent values with no or negligible deviations from the given value (e.g. dimensions or resolution of a setting parameter). Compliance is ensured by design. Typical data (typ.) Characterizes product performance by means of representative information for the given parameter. When marked with <, > or as a range, it represents the performance met by approximately 80 % of the instruments at production time. Otherwise, it represents the mean value. Nominal values (nom.) Characterize product performance by means of a representative value for the given parameter (e.g. nominal impedance). In contrast to typical data, a statistical evaluation does not take place and the parameter is not tested during production. Measured values (meas.) Characterize expected product performance by means of measurement results gained from individual samples. Uncertainties Represent limits of measurement uncertainty for a given measurand. Uncertainty is defined with a coverage factor of 2 and has been calculated in line with the rules of the Guide to the Expression of Uncertainty in Measurement (GUM), taking into account environmental conditions, aging, wear and tear. Typical data as well as nominal and measured values are not warranted by Rohde & Schwarz. 4 Rohde & Schwarz R&S ETL TV Analyzer

M/H subframe structure based on TPC full FIC parameter analysis of all transmitted parades/ensembles list of M/H-service-based FIC parameters for all parades/ensembles M/H service overview M/H service overview graphical view of occupied M/H slots during the last 7 M/H frames, use of M/H subframe for M/H data FIC header: FIC chunk major protocol version, FIC chunk minor protocol version, FIC chunk header extension length, ensemble loop header extension length, MH service loop extension length, reserved bit, transport stream ID, number of ensembles FIC data of selected parade: SLT ensemble indicator, GAT ensemble indicator, ensemble protocol version, service signaling channel version, reserved bits, number of services M/H service parameter of selected parade: ensemble ID, number of services, service ID, multi-ensemble, service status, service protection indicator, reserved bits; if SLT-M/H is transmitted: service name, service category simultaneous display of all transmitted M/H services: parade ID, ensemble ID, number of services, service ID; if SLT-M/H is transmitted: service name, service category simultaneous display of all transmitted M/H services: parade ID, ensemble ID, number of services, service ID; if SLT-M/H is transmitted: service name, service category Measurement uncertainty Bit rate measurements referenced to transport stream bit rate reference uncertainty With R&S FSL-B4 OCXO Bit rate measurements referenced to transport stream bit rate reference uncertainty With external 10 MHz reference (f 1 GHz) Bit rate measurements referenced to transport stream bit rate 1 Hz Ensemble BER before Reed-Solomon to , exponent Ensemble RS packet error ratio to , exponent Ensemble M/H transport packet error ratio to , exponent Signaling BER before Reed-Solomon to , exponent Signaling packet error ratio to , exponent The current firmware version does not support dynamic reconfiguration of the ATSC Mobile DTV decoder based on the TPC signaling parameters. If the TPC signaling parameters are changed at the transmitter end while the R&S ETL decodes a parade, this will result in a short sync loss of the decoded parade until the new TPC parameters are used for decoding in the R&S ETL.
